ELECTRONICOVENCONTROL
When you first plug in the range, "PF" will appear on the
display until you press any command button. If "PF" again
appears on the the display, your electricity was off for a while.
You will need to reset the clock and reprogram any
temperature adjustments you may have made. See "Setting
the Clock" on page 8; and "Adjusting Oven Temperature
Control" on page 12.
When you are using the oven, the display will show preheat
times and temperature settings.
When you are not using the self-cleaning function or cooking
with the oven, the display will show time of day.
When setting a function, if you do not press the START button
within 5 seconds, the START? indicator light will flash. If you
do not press the START button within 5 minutes, the function
will be canceled.
After setting a function for the first time, you must press the
START button to start the function.
An indicator light to the left of the display lights up when you are
using an oven function, when the oven door is locked, and when
the oven is on.
The control lock lets you disable the control panel command
buttons. The control lock comes in handy when you want to
prevent others from using the oven.
NOTES :
You can only use the control lock when the oven is not in use
or the control has not been set.
Set the control lock when cleaning the control panel to
prevent yourself from accidentally turning on the oven.
You must reset the control lock if the power goes out for more
than 1 second.
To lock the control panel :
Press and hold the STARTbutton for 5 seconds.
The OFF button will cancel any function except the clock, minute
timer, and control lock.
You will hear a single tone and "Loc" will appear on the display
for 5 seconds. "Loc" and "START?" will then appear whenever a
command button is pressed.
To unlock the control panel :
Press and hold the STARTbutton for 5 seconds.
You will hear a single tone and "Loc" and "START?" will
disappear from the display.
